Importance of Nondisclosure Agreements<\/h2>\n\n\n\n

Noncompete and nondisclosure agreements are legal contracts<\/a> between you and your employees. These types of contracts aim to protect your businesses by preventing the disclosure of information that other companies consider proprietary, such as customer lists, trade secrets, and sensitive information.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

A noncompete agreement ensures that your employee will not use the information gained while working for you to start a business and compete with your career once the job is over. It also ensures that your company maintains its market position. A noncompete agreement is intended to safeguard the best interest of your company and employee.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

Nondisclosure agreements give you peace of mind in long-term business engagements when confidential information must be exchanged between the parties. It will safeguard your trade secrets, client list, and other sensitive information. Your business relationship will be secure if your confidential information is handled. It will restrict your employee from disclosing sensitive information to a third party.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

<\/a>Laws on Noncompete and Nondisclosure Agreements<\/h2>\n\n\n\n

Noncompete and nondisclosure agreements are governed by state law. As a business owner, it is important to be aware of the specific laws in your state that affect the use of these agreements. As a result, the enforceability of these agreements can vary from state to state.<\/p>\n\n\n\n
